Nature of Tungsten disulfide

Tungsten disulfide is a compound of tungsten and sulfur, with the chemical formula WS2 and a molecular weight of 247.97. It is a black-gray powder and occurs in nature as wolframite, a dark gray rhombic crystalline solid. The relative density is 7.510.

Slightly soluble in cold water and soluble in hot water [2]. Insoluble in hydrochloric acid and alkali (except for mixtures of concentrated nitric acid and hydrofluoric acid). Soluble in molten alkali, insoluble in alcohol. Density 7.6g · cm-3. It has reducibility and can react with potent oxidizing agents such as hot concentrated sulfuric acid, nitric acid, and aqua regia. It can be converted into WO3 when heated in air or oxygen. [1] Heating to 1250 ℃ in a vacuum decomposes into tungsten and sulfur. In a dry pure nitrogen gas stream, the tungsten trisulfide and sulfur mixture is co-heated to 900 ℃ to sublimate the excess sulfur, resulting in the tungsten disulfide residue.

 

Advantages of Tungsten disulfide

1. It has a very low coefficient of friction (0.03), high extreme pressure resistance, and oxidation resistance (it starts to decompose at 450°C in air, completely decomposes at 650°C, and starts to decompose at 1100°C in a vacuum, and completely decomposes at 2000°C). It is suitable for lubrication under harsh conditions such as high temperature, high pressure, high vacuum, high load, high speed, high radiation, strong corrosion, and ultra-low temperature.

2. It has good adsorption capacity on the metal surface. It can be added to engineering plastics to make lubricating components or evenly mixed with some volatile solvents, then sprayed on the metal surface to improve the die's life and the workpiece's surface finish in punching and forging.

3. Tungsten disulfide powder can be mixed with oil and fat to form tungsten disulfide oil, tungsten disulfide ointment, tungsten disulfide wax, and other solid lubricating blocks and lubricating films.

 

Application of Tungsten disulfide

It can be used as a lubricant with better performance than molybdenum disulfide, a lower coefficient of friction, and higher compressive strength and used solely for high temperature, high pressure, high speed, high load, and equipment operating in chemically active media. The forging and stamping lubricant configured with other materials can prolong the die's life and improve the product's smoothness. Filling materials such as PTFE and nylon can be used to make self-lubricating parts. [2]

In addition, tungsten disulfide can also be used as a catalyst in the petrochemical field. Its advantages are high cracking performance, stable and reliable catalytic activity, and long service life.
